Brief Summary

Breast microcalcifications are a common mammographic finding. Microcalcifications are considered suspicious signs of breast cancer and a breast biopsy is required, however, cancer is diagnosed in only a few patients. Reducing unnecessary biopsies and rapid characterization of breast microcalcifications are unmet clinical needs. This study intends to implement a classification method for breast microcalcifications (as begnin or malign) with Artificial Intelligence techniques on mammographic images, evaluating the diagnostic performance (accuracy) of this approach. Another aim is the development of a diagnostic tool able to determining in-situ the biomolecular characteristics of microcalcifications. Raman spectroscopy (RS) is a highly specific method from the biomolecular point of view and it is able to explore molecular composition of a given sample through its direct irradiation (through laser light) and the simultaneous acquisition of emission signals. RS information could be combined togheter with imaging features to implement an AI model for the combined classification of breast microcalcifications

Study Population

Breast patological patients who experience microcalcification lesion

You may qualify if:

  • Female subjects;
  • Age between 18 and 88 years;
  • Detection of microcalcifications on clinical and screening mammography with or without indication for histological assessment by biopsy;
  • Subjects who agree to participate in the study by signing and dating the Informed Consent form

You may not qualify if:

  • Personal history of breast cancer
